German Post-Socialist Memory Culture : Epistemic Nostalgia /
"After German unification, former officers of the GDR state security service united with GDR professors and cultural managers to establish the East German Committee of Associations (OKV). On the basis of encompassing oral history into this complex web of interest organizations and memory clubs,...
